Transaction e568d62a9707a7233219a45d09f4168d65d31367eb8cfd8d794f055b45b3cac8
2 Input
2 Outputs
- e568d62a9707a7233219a45d09f4168d65d31367eb8cfd8d794f055b45b3cac8:0
- e568d62a9707a7233219a45d09f4168d65d31367eb8cfd8d794f055b45b3cac8:1
value 2527998
address 1D3UyRPR9Xo15wNugqMKxF9FpWpZ7MnzC9
value 39231
address 15DMFHGDeJyAMDnqrqNPksFp4km5D2Y8gP